HG mould spray does an excellent job but you don't wipe it off until it actually killed the mould, the mould will disappear
as the spray kills it leaving the paint clean.
Best to give it a second spray and leave for a couple of days if you can. even with the room well ventilated it will still be hard to stick.
Any surfaces where its applied will also need well washed before painting or the paint will flake.
